Menorca

On Menorca just a single power plant exist at Mahon ( Maó ) at 39°53′49″N 4°15′31″E / 39.89694°N 4.25861°E / 39.89694; 4.25861 (Mahon ( Maó ) Power Station). It has a net generation capacity of 245 MW. From it 2 132 kV-lines run to Dragonera substation.

Power cable to Mallorca

A 132 kV-line links Ciutadella substation on Menorca with Es Bessons substation on Mallorca. It runs from Ciutadella substation overhead to Celan Bosch cable terminal at 39°55′55″N 3°50′1″E / 39.93194°N 3.83361°E / 39.93194; 3.83361 (Celan Bosch cable terminal) where the submarine cable to Mallorca starts. It ends at Cala Mesquida cable terminal at Cala Mesquida 39°44′19″N 3°25′38″E / 39.73861°N 3.42722°E / 39.73861; 3.42722 (Cala Mesquida terminal), where the overhead line to Es Bessons substation starts.

Ibiza/Formentera

On Ibiza and Formentera, there are two thermal power stations, one on Ibiza, the other on Formentera.

69 kV/15 kV substation

The substations on Ibiza are interconnected together with Elvissa Power Station over a 69 kV-ring running from Elvissa Power Station via Torrent, Santa Eularia, Sant Antoni and Sant Jordi. Beside this, there is a connection between Torrent and San Antonio. Since 2007 a 69 kV-cable with a capacity of 50 MW connects the powergrid of Formentera with that of Ibiza. The terminals of this cable are Torrent and Formentera Power Station. From Torrent a 132 kV three phase AC link to Santa Ponsa, Mallorca is under construction (capacity 2 x 100 MV).

HVDC-connection to the mainland

An HVDC cable (±250 kV) with the name Cometa has been commissioned in August 2012. The converter substation is at Santa Ponsa 39°32′2″N 2°30′21″E / 39.53389°N 2.50583°E / 39.53389; 2.50583 (Santa Ponsa HVDC Static-Inverter Plant). It will also contain a 220 kV/132 kV-substation, from which a 132 kV submarine cable for three-phase AC will run to Torrent on Ibiza.

220 kV/69 kV-Substations

The backbone of power supply of Mallorca is the 220 kV grid. The following stations are in service

2 lines interconnect Valldurgent with Son Reus, Llubi with Murterar PowerStation and Llubi with Es Bessons substation. A single ring-line interconnects Llubi, Son Reus and Son Orlandis substation. New 220 kV-substations are planned/under construction at Santa Ponsa, Rafal, Latzer and Lucmajor. A three-phase 132 kV AC cable between Es Bessons and Ciutadella on Menorca is under construction.
